New project gelding, broke and has been ridden english and western, not started in anything specific.
I had a Chick's Beduino mare for several years, really liked her. She was a granddaughter of Chicks Beduino out of a TB mare though. Also have experience with First Down Dash horses. Heza Fast Man/Streakin Six is a new area for me. So can anyone give me some opinions/thoughts on the mix of horses on this guy's papers?

Just a little FYI....his 4th dam, Sweet Blush, is the dam of Blushing Bug and Leaving Memories, among other pretty nice runners and is 1/2 sister to Kingdom Key.
